Mahalapye Central Police are investigating a case of stock theft after four men were arrested in connection with the theft of goats at Lose Lands on the outskirts of Mahalapye.

The matter was reported by a 38-year-old man from Xhosa 1 ward, Mahalapye, recently, after discovering that his goats had gone missing.

Confirming the incident, Mahalapye Central Police Station commander, Superintendent Meshack Ranku, said the four suspects, aged between 32 and 42, were arrested at Radisele village after being found in possession of eight goats suspected to have been stolen.
